Question 1: Where is the pilgrimage to Saint Spiridon's relics held?

The pilgrimage to Saint Spiridon's relics takes place in Corfu, Greece, where the incorrupt remains of the saint are enshrined in the Church of Saint Spiridon.

Question 2: What is the significance of Saint Spiridon's relics?

Saint Spiridon's relics are believed to possess miraculous powers, having been associated with numerous healings, interventions, and blessings throughout history.

Tips

Undertake a pilgrimage to the relics of Saint Spyridon to seek his intercession and experience his miraculous presence. Here are some tips to enhance your pilgrimage:

Tip 1: Prepare spiritually

Before embarking on your pilgrimage, engage in spiritual preparation through prayer, fasting, and reflection. This will help you align your heart and mind with the purpose of your journey.

Tip 2: Research the saint

Familiarize yourself with the life and miracles of Saint Spyridon by reading Sveti Spiridon: A Pilgrimage To The Relics Of A Miraculous Saint or other reputable sources. This will deepen your understanding of his holiness and inspire your devotion.

Tip 3: Respect local customs

When visiting the relics, observe local customs and traditions. Dress modestly, maintain a reverent demeanor, and follow any specific instructions provided by the clergy.

Tip 4: Bring a memento

Consider bringing a small object or piece of fabric to be blessed at the relics. This memento can serve as a tangible reminder of your pilgrimage and a source of spiritual comfort.

Tip 5: Allow ample time

Dedicate sufficient time for your pilgrimage to fully immerse yourself in the experience. This will allow you to participate in liturgies, venerate the relics, and explore the surrounding area connected to Saint Spyridon's life.
